With Hashem's assist, I not too long ago stumbled on a commentary on Tehilim prepared by Rav Chaim Kanievsky z’l. To know Tehilim, it is important to grasp the background and historical context with the chapter that David Hamelech is composing about. What exactly was taking place in his in everyday life when he wrote it? From time to time he tells us what exactly’s going on while in the heading, regardless of whether he’s running absent, remaining chased, and so on. But from time to time he would not. And sometimes, it seems like he is telling us what's going on, but we actually Do not get it. Rav Chaim Kanievsky, together with his incredible understanding of Torah, finds a Midrash that assists us comprehend 1 this sort of chapter. Chapter 30 known as Mizmor Shir, Hanukat HaBayit L’David/a tune to the dedication of the home, referring to the Wager Hamikdash, by David. There are 2 problems with this. Number 1 is always that David Hamelech wasn't with the Hanukat HaBayit- he died right before that. As we’ve discussed previously, Rashi describes that he wrote it being stated for the Hanukat Habayit. The second issue is that there is no discussion of your Hanukat HaBayit Within this Mizmor. It says, אֲרוֹמִמְךָ֣ ה׳ כִּ֣י דִלִּיתָ֑נִי God lifted me up… שִׁוַּ֥עְתִּי אֵ֝לֶ֗יךָ וַתִּרְפָּאֵֽנִי I referred to as out to You and you also healed me. You carry me through the depths, etc. What does which have to perform with the Hanukat Habayit? Even more into the perek, it says, הֲיוֹדְךָ֥ עָפָ֑ר הֲיַגִּ֥יד אֲמִתֶּֽךָ׃ Will Dust praise You and say in excess of Your truth? לְמַ֤עַן ׀ יְזַמֶּרְךָ֣ כָ֭בוֹד וְלֹ֣א יִדֹּ֑ם יְהֹוָ֥ה אֱ֝לֹהַ֗י לְעוֹלָ֥ם אוֹדֶֽךָּ To make sure that my soul will sing to you personally for good.. So, again, what's going on? Rav Chaim cites a Midrash that David Hamelech was sick for 13 a long time, as he suggests in a unique perek, יָגַ֤עְתִּי ׀ בְּֽאַנְחָתִ֗י אַשְׂחֶ֣ה בְכׇל־לַ֭יְלָה מִטָּתִ֑י בְּ֝דִמְעָתִ֗י עַרְשִׂ֥י אַמְסֶֽה Each and every night time I am crying in my bed . So he experienced for 13 several years, And through this time his enemies hoping he’d die. David Hamelech was of course praying to acquire from this situation. What acquired him outside of it? He eventually came up with the next prayer, “ Please help save me in order that I am going to contain the strength to approach the Bet Hamikdash,” and t hat's when he got from his mattress and wrote what’s called the Megilat Binyan Bet Hamikdash/ the architectural plans for that Guess a HaMikdash, and God heard his prayer.

This 7 days’s Parasha , Teruma talks regarding the donations on the Mishkan . It suggests there, “ Tell the Jewish men and women, ‘Allow them to take for Me a donation.” The question all the commentaries question is, Shouldn’t it have said, “ You need to give Me a donation?” You don't have a donation. The Guess Halevi explains that the primary income that someone possesses is definitely the money that he presents to Sedaka. Any dollars that he takes advantage of for his have particular satisfaction, he did not genuinely get ; it’s not really his . He savored it, but it is not his. It truly is bitachon squandered. But The cash that you choose to give to Sedaka is yours . He claims this is really located in a Gemara in Masechet Bava Batra 11a, the place or discusses The nice king Mumbaz, who, inside of a time of famine, gave away his treasure homes to charity. His relations mentioned, “ Your forefathers amassed wealth and also you're offering it absent?!” And his reply was, “ My forefathers put away the prosperity for Some others, And that i set it away for myself.” Because the Sedaka which you give is yourself. The Gemara in Eruvin 54a states When you've got money, do superior on your own. Many people understand it to mean, In case you have income, love yourself. Though the Guess Halevi says that's a misunderstanding . Should you have revenue, handle you usually means give Sedaka, since that's the way you happen to be taking care of yourself. There is a well known Tale with regards to the Chafetz Chaim and a person who wrote a will. The person left his dollars to all his children, his grandchildren, his nephews, nieces his aged Trainer and in many cases his Doggy. And he wanted to know When the Chafetz Chaim agreed Together with the will. The Chafetz Chaim stated, “ You remaining 1 man or woman out of the will.” The man questioned, “ Who'd I go away out? I lined Every person.” The Chafetz Chaim explained to him that he’d left himself out, since the only cash that you've got is the money which you give absent. And therefore, the pasuk claims, “ Vayikhu Li Teruma/ Consider for Me. The Guess Halevi provides mashal that’s slightly morbid. He says, Picture a glass box. Inside the box there is a significant sugar cube and also a fly flying around. The fly is all fired up With all the sugar dice that he has. But he doesn't know that he does not have it. He is locked within the box While using the sugar cube and it's not likely his. So far too, The cash that someone owns is not the money that is locked down in this article with him.
